The cruise industry has experienced incredible growth and diversification over the last half century. For better or worse, today’s cruise vacation is a vastly different experience than it was 50 years ago. Students learn how holidays at sea have evolved in terms of ship size, accommodations, onboard amenities, food, service and pricing. We explore how to differentiate cruise ships and discuss the impact of COVID-19 on the industry and ongoing health and environmental issues.
